## v3.2.0 — Setting renamed

Hey plugin folks: we renamed `ORDERS_TOMBSTONE_MODE` to `ORDERS_SOFT_DELETE` in Cartfell 3.2. Soft-deleted rows in the orders table now keep their line items, so your plugins should stop assuming cascaded wipes. Update your env files accordingly — the old name is ignored as of this release. Right after the renamed setting, the orders-archive encryption secret goes on the following line.

env line for baduf-hahog: RELAY_SECRET3=c4a

**Alert: Cold Start Latency — Flintbox Handlers**

Heads up, plugin folks: Flintbox serverless handlers are hitting cold starts above the 1.2s budget, mostly after deploys or idle windows. If your plugin hooks into invocation startup, keep init work lean and lazy-load heavy deps. Full warming strategy and tuning knobs are documented on our internal page.

dashboard of bafof-hafog = https://confluence.lumiclabs.internal/display/browse/display/6a09a20a

## Service Accounts & Cold Starts

Heads up, plugin folks: Fenwick Cloud serverless handlers can take a couple of seconds on a cold start while the runtime fetches service account tokens. Don't fetch credentials inside your handler body — do it at init so warm invocations skip the round trip. If your plugin calls the Hearthbeat warmup service to keep instances alive, authenticate with the dedicated svc-plugin-warm account rather than your personal token. The key for the Hearthbeat internal API is provided below.

gateway credential: kto23_LX9A4ys6i4nzHtpOLNLodKK

**Q: How do I pull new translation strings out of the app?**

Easy — run the `lexiscrape` script from the Polyglot repo root and it'll walk every template, grab anything wrapped in `tr()`, and dump a fresh catalog file. Don't hand-edit the catalog; it gets overwritten. Flags, quirks, and the list of supported file types live on the Lexiscrape wiki page.

operations page: https://jenkins.zemvarcloud.local/job/merge_requests/repo/build/73930b4b30f0a8ed